The people over at Unreal Admin Page tossed up an interview with Epic Games Joe "DrSin" Wilcox about some UT2003 Server only questions. Here is a clip:
Shaggy: Can we have an in game graphical interface to set admin/game options fitted as standard - I find the command line stuff too slow and easily screwed up so it would be nice if I didn't have to wait around for ages until some nice person wrote a mod for it.?
DrSin: Yes, but probably not until the first patch. Michel Comeau (DarkByte) is doing it once all the default in-game menus are done. He also wrote the new web admin system so I would expect it to follow the functionality fairly closely.
